Both calibers are popular, but Federal lists 35 varieties of .30-06 and only 22 kinds of 7mm Rem. Mag. The cheapest 7mm Rem. Mag. from Federal costs $1.95 per round for a box of 20 while the .30-06 is only $1.30 per round for 20. For quality hunting cartridges, the .30-06 is also $5 to $10 cheaper for a box of 20.For most of its 60 years, the 7mm Remington Magnum has been the hunter's go-to, and it has not lost its luster entirely. The 6.5 with 156 Berger will actually have every so slightly better ballistic performance than 7mm RM with the 175gn.There is one thing the 6.8 Western has over the 7mm rem mag - it can run in a short action. From a 'performance' standpoint, the 6.8 Western is basically a 270 win on a short action. The real benefit is fast twists for heavy bullets. That is something all 6.8 westerns will have that not all 7mm RM's have either. Many are 1-9.5".

The 7mm-08 is less powerful than the 7mm Rem Mag, but also has less recoil and is better suited for smaller game like deer. The 7mm Rem Mag is a larger cartridge better for long range shooting and big game like elk or moose. The 300 Win Mag typically has more recoil and more kinetic energy up close, but the 7mm PRC has a flatter trajectory, better resistance to wind deflection, and more kinetic energy at extended range.The 7 SAUM (Short Action Ultra Magnum) was introduced in 2002 by Remington as part of its Ultra Magnum line. It is designed to fit into a short action rifle and has a shorter case length than the 7mm Rem Mag. The cartridge uses a 0.284-inch diameter bullet and has a case length of 2.035 inches. The .300 RUM (or ultra mag) was a specially modified .404 Jeffery case necked down so it could use .308 bullets. The case is longer than the PRC at 2.845 inches but remained a popular cartridge with big game hunters due to its tremendous energy over distance. Great care has been given by Hornady engineers to develop superior, match­-accurate hunting loads that allow the ELD­-X ® bullet to achieve its maximum ballistic ...This makes sense as the .270 Winchester is designed for use in standard or long actions rifles (same as the 30-06) while the 6.5 PRC and 6.8 Western are considered short action cartridges. The .270 Winchester has a .473″ rim diameter while the 6.5 PRC and 6.8 Western have larger .532″ and .535″ rim diameters.

However, the 7mm Remington Magnum has a larger .532″ rim diameter while the .30-06 has a .473″ rim diameter. At the same time, the 7mm Rem Mag has a steeper 25 degree shoulder (the .30-06 has a 17.5 degree shoulder) that also sits a tiny bit further forward than the shoulder of the .30-06. Out of the muzzle, the 7mm Rem Mag is flying 90 ft/s faster than the .30-06. At 300 yards, that advantage has expanded to 186 ft/s. By 500 yards, the 7mm Rem Mag is flying 238 ft/s faster than the .30-06. We can see that the 7mm Rem Mag maintains its speed better over longer distances, as its advantage only grows as we cross more distance.Oct 3, 2020 · As the names imply, the .300 Win Mag takes a 30-cal (.308″) bullet, while the 7mm Rem Mag takes a smaller caliber (.284″) bullet. The case and overall length of the .300 Win Mag are slightly longer than the 7mm RM, and its overall case capacity has a larger volume. Stability map for 168 grain VLD. The idea of using a belted case shortened to fit in a .30-06 length action really came to the forefront in the 1950s, with Winchester's release of the .458, .338 and .264 Winchester Magnums. However, using a 2.500-inch belted case was not an original design. Working practices have undergone significant changes in...With an overall length of 3.7″, the 300 PRC requires a magnum length rifle action. At the same time, the .300 PRC actually has a tiny bit shorter case length than the .300 Win Mag (2.62″ vs 2.58″). Now that we have looked at the short answer, we ...Everything else being equal, the smaller diameter 7mm bullets have a higher ballistic coefficient and a higher sectional density than the larger diameter bullets of the same weight from the .300 Winchester Magnum. However, the .300 Winchester Magnum generally uses heavier bullets than the 7mm Remington Magnum.
